Pharmacological strategies to decrease excessive blood loss in cardiac surgery: a meta-analysis of clinically

Pharmacological strategies like aprotinin and lysine analogues significantly reduce mortality and rethoracotomy rates in cardiac surgery patients. These agents also decrease the need for blood transfusions, improving patient outcomes.

Background:
- Excessive bleeding is a significant complication in cardiac surgery, increasing morbidity and mortality.
- Previous trials showed pharmacological agents reduce blood loss but often lacked power for clinical outcomes.
- A meta-analysis was conducted on aprotinin, lysine analogues, and desmopressin for perioperative bleeding reduction.
Purpose of the Study:
- To evaluate the efficacy of three pharmacological strategies in reducing perioperative bleeding in cardiac surgery.
- To assess the impact of these strategies on clinically relevant outcomes, including mortality and transfusion rates.
Main Methods:
- Meta-analysis of 72 randomized controlled trials involving 8409 patients.
- Inclusion criteria required reporting of clinical outcomes (mortality, rethoracotomy, transfusion, myocardial infarction) alongside blood loss.
- Separate analysis for studies on complicated cardiac surgery.
Main Results:
- Aprotinin nearly halved mortality (OR 0.55) and, with lysine analogues, reduced rethoracotomy rates (OR 0.37-0.44).
- Both aprotinin and lysine analogues significantly decreased allogeneic blood transfusion requirements.
- Desmopressin showed minimal blood loss reduction without clinical benefit and increased myocardial infarction risk (OR 2.4).
Conclusions:
- Pharmacological agents, particularly aprotinin and lysine analogues, effectively reduce perioperative blood loss in cardiac surgery.
- These agents are associated with decreased mortality, rethoracotomy, and transfusion rates.
- Desmopressin is not recommended due to lack of clinical benefit and increased risk of myocardial infarction.
